Preparing Your Home for a La Grange newborn photography Lifestyle Session
When planning your La Grange newborn photography experience, the light in your home plays a huge role. For this family, waiting for a sunny day meant we could utilize the nursery. The olive walls and the reflection in their round mirror to create something unique.
If you are looking to bring your own Pinterest inspiration to life, here are three tips:
- Clear the Clutter: You don’t need a perfect home. In fact the more character the better. Clearing off bedside tables or nursery dressers helps the focus stay on your connection.
- Include the Pets: Dogs are family too! We make sure they are comfortable and calm so we can get those sweet “sibling” shots with the new baby.
- Trust the Light: Sometimes the best spot in the house isn’t the most decorated one—it’s the one with the best window light.
